[파이썬] if/for/while 문에서 else의 역할
1. if - elif - else
- elif는 여러개 사용할 수 있다.
- if부터 순차적으로 조건을 검사하여
- 만족하면 조건문 실행,
- 만족하지 못하면 다음 구문의 조건을 검사한다.
(1) if
(2) if - else
(3) if - elif - else
(4) if - elif - elif - ... - elif - else
2. for - else
- else문은 for문이 중간에 break 등으로 끊기지 않고, 끝까지 수행 되었을 때 수행하는 코드 를 담고있다.
- else의 들여쓰기는 for과 일치해야 함
(1) for
(2) for - else
3. while - else
- else문은 while문이 중간에 break 등으로 끊기지 않고, 끝까지 수행 되었을 때 수행하는 코드 를 담고있다.
- else의 들여쓰기는 while과 일치해야 함
(1) while
(2) while - else